Transaction 90a85248169bea98470b9caa2e7bb1b147d90dae0dc4efd4b5c5a3a0305c483d

5 Input
1 Outputs
  • 90a85248169bea98470b9caa2e7bb1b147d90dae0dc4efd4b5c5a3a0305c483d:0
  • value  1498451
    address  1DsU5VTxuQHrtzijxFcKPr85przbq9RWtd